Tsunami (July 21-23, 2023)

This music festival takes place in the north of Spain, Gijón, Asturias. Apart from offering some of the most beautiful landscapes – and cider – this month it will also offer some of the best music at the crossroads between old punk and new rock.

The lineup for July 2023 includes Descendents, Dropkick Murphys, Me First and the Gimme Gimmes, and Wolfmother.

Les Nuit Secrètes (July 21-23, 2023)

Les Nuit Secrètes takes place in Aulnoye-Aymeries, a small town in northern France, and it’s not just about music. It is also known as an arts festival that is known for its unique concept and intimate atmosphere. It features a diverse lineup of indie, alternative, and electronic music, as well as various other art forms.

If you’re lucky and get your hands on a festival ticket, you’ll have the chance to see the following artists and bands live: Boris Brejcha, The Blaze, Angèle, Jain, Lomepal, etc.

Low (July 28-30, 2023)

Low is an annual music festival that takes place in Benidorm, Spain. So, if you’re expecting a lively and diverse atmosphere, you’d be on point. Festival-goers can enjoy the festival’s sustainable initiatives, paradisiac beaches, and a mix of genres, such as indie, rock, pop, electronic, etc. Not bad at all.

It’s also known to attract both national and international artists and bands which, this July, will include: Placebo, Interpol, Vetusta Morla, Django Django, and Cupido, just to name a few.

Latitude Festival (July 20-23, 2023)

Latitude Festival is a popular annual music and arts festival held in Henham Park, Suffolk, England. It’s not just music that you’ll find; the lineup includes comedy, theatre, and spoken word performances. Although it’s not exclusively an indie music festival, it definitely is a platform for indie bands and artists to share their work. This year, here are some of the amazing artists scheduled to perform: black midi, George Ezra, James, Metronomy, and Men I Trust.

Kendal Calling (July 27-30, 2023)

Kendal Calling is a popular annual music festival held in the Lake District, Cumbria, England. The venue is famous for its scenic location and vibrant atmosphere the genres include indie, rock, pop, electronic, and more. What’s also great is that, it’s not just about music here either; this festival attracts all types of audiences as it’s a family-friendly environment: there are dedicated areas and activities for kids, on-site camping, art installations, comedy acts, and plenty of food!

The lineup includes artists we’re sure you heard in many of our curated playlists: Annie Mac, beabadoobee, Kasabian, Royal Blood, Kaiser Chiefs, Rick Astley, The Lathums, Example, etc.

Pitchfork (July 21-23, 2023)

Although Pitchfork is also known for its considerable size, it’s also known for its genre selection (indie, alternative, and experimental artists) and curated lineup selection. This Chicago-based musical fest is held in Union Park.

Once again, we’re sure you’re going to recognize many of these artists and bands from our very own playlists: Bon Iver, Snail Mail, Weyes Blood, Kelela, The Alchemist, etc.
